#26d1c5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#26d1c5 is composed of 14.9% red, 82%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.7%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 175.8 degrees, a saturation of 69.2% and a lightness of 48.4%. #26d1c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#4cffff with #00a38b.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#26d1c5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#26d1c5 has RGB values of R:38, G:209,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0, Y:0.06,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 2544069.
